Minecraft

Our end of year project has been Minecraft.  Thanks to our donors who purchased a MinecraftEdu license for us so that we could have a safe learning environment.  This project was also a collaboration with the Thinkery.  The students were tasked with creating a community.  Second through fifth grade participated in this community.  They decided what buildings we needed and they built them either on their own or with others in the room.  They learned many SEL lessons while collaborating on this project.  They built things like libraries, swimming pools, water slides, roller coasters, homes, restaurants, zoos, schools, tree houses, parkour stations, underground caves, underwater science labs, and much more.  I'm super proud of their teamwork, building skills, and their pride on our society online!
